Abstract: It is shown that, with the only exception of n=2, the Einstein-Hilbert action in n+D+d dimensions, with n times, is invariant under the duality transformation aofrac1a and bofrac1b, where a is a Friedmann-Robertson-Walker scale factor in D dimensions and b a Brans-Dicke scalar field in d dimensions respectively. We investigate the 2+D+d dimensional cosmological model in some detail.
